Output 8ec17fdaaf4e0abcd51a42ec6a7e35bd69ecfd4bdd628ba9ffe35d0f714337ab:4

value
432664380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735d4de855597997b21588cc78ca2db696be1c5d OP_EQUAL
address
3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om
transaction
8ec17fdaaf4e0abcd51a42ec6a7e35bd69ecfd4bdd628ba9ffe35d0f714337ab
confirmations
426250
spent
true